‘Serviced enriched housing’ can deliver double-digit growth for retirement village operators

1 min read

Lyn Katzmann (pictured), keynote speaker at the RLC Summit and CEO of New Jersey (USA) based 23 site Juniper Communities, explained that retirement villages are in a unique position to deliver ‘services enriched housing’, what she calls a win-win business case for retirement villages which will:

  • improve care and resident outcomes
  • increase customer satisfaction
  • contain or lower government care expenditure

She has identified that delivering wellness in her village communities has delivered double-digit revenue growth (current revenue $85M pa).

Prevention is the real key to health, addressing chronic disease and disability, leading to increased life expectancy.

“We provide health; we provide the services that effectively manage chronic health”.

Branded ‘Connect4Life’, Juniper has re-engineered its business around the provision of a Medical Concierge in each community. This person’s job is to coordinate health services, coach residents and closely view comprehensive datasets for alerts in changes of behaviour.

Ms Katzmann described the program as a triple win – resident health and quality of life improves, the sector creates value for the health sector and unlocks public policy, and local health providers become a very active referral base for future customers to her communities.
